Your Appointment

Please read the bullet points below or check out the pages on the left to learn more about what you can expect during your visit. If you have any questions about your appointment, please don’t hesitate to contact us.

  • If you have a change in your physical condition before surgery such as a cold, fever, persistent cough or rash; contact a nurse at the Eye Surgery Center at (270) 442-1024.
  • Arrangements should be made prior to your surgery for someone to drive you home.
  • You cannot drive yourself. Driver is requested to stay at the Eye Surgery Center during your procedure.
  • It is recommended that a responsible adult stay with you the first night after surgery.
  • DO NOT EAT OR DRINK 6 HOURS BEFORE SURGERY.
  • You may take your morning medications with a small amount of water unless otherwise instructed. Bring all inhalers or diabetic medications with you the day of surgery.
  • Do not take diabetic medications day of surgery unless a nurse instructs you to do so.
  • Wear loose fitting clothing and a shirt that is short sleeve, or a shirt that is able to push above your elbows.
  • Do not wear any facial or eye make-up.
  • Your dentures will not be removed for surgery.
  • The day before surgery, a nurse will call your home to confirm or change arrival time for surgery. This call will normally be in the afternoon the day before your surgery. Additional instructions will be given to the patient at this time. If you will not be at home, please leave us a phone number where you can be reached.
  • You will be at the Eye Surgery Center for approximately 2-3 hours on the day of your surgery. At times, unavoidable circumstances can cause a delay, and we appreciate your patience.
  • Bring all your eye drops with you the day of surgery.
